Underground Cities

When visiting Cappadocia, don’t miss the opportunity to explore the captivating underground cities that lie beneath the surface. Two of the most famous underground cities in the region are Derinkuyu and Kaymakli, each offering a unique glimpse into the historical significance and architectural marvels of these subterranean wonders.

Derinkuyu, with its intricate network of tunnels and chambers, is believed to have been built as early as the 8th century BC and served as a refuge for the region’s inhabitants during times of conflict. Descending into its depths, you’ll discover multi-level living quarters, ventilation shafts, and even a church, all carved out of the soft volcanic rock. It’s a fascinating journey back in time, providing insight into the daily lives of the people who once sought shelter here.

Kaymakli, another remarkable underground city, offers a similar experience. With its eight levels and maze-like corridors, it is one of the largest underground cities in Cappadocia. As you wander through its narrow passages, you’ll come across rooms used for various purposes, including storage, stables, and even a winery. The ingenious ventilation system and intricate architectural details are a testament to the advanced engineering skills of the ancient inhabitants.

Fairy Chimneys

Fairy Chimneys: When visiting Cappadocia, one cannot miss the opportunity to marvel at the whimsical fairy chimneys that dot the landscape. These unique rock formations, which resemble towering mushrooms, have captivated visitors for centuries. As you wander through the surreal landscapes of Cappadocia, you’ll encounter these natural wonders that seem straight out of a fairy tale.

The fairy chimneys are a result of millions of years of geological processes, shaped by volcanic eruptions and erosion. The soft volcanic rock known as tuff has eroded over time, leaving behind these fascinating formations. Some of the fairy chimneys even have conical caps made of harder rock, protecting the softer rock underneath from further erosion.

Legend has it that these fairy chimneys were once inhabited by mystical creatures. According to local folklore, fairies used to live in these chimneys, emerging at night to dance and play. These legends add an enchanting element to the already magical atmosphere of Cappadocia.

Rock-Cut Churches

Visit the rock-cut churches of Cappadocia, such as the Göreme Open Air Museum, and admire the intricate frescoes and religious history preserved within these ancient cave churches.

Cappadocia is home to a remarkable collection of rock-cut churches, showcasing the region’s rich religious history and artistic heritage. One of the must-visit sites is the Göreme Open Air Museum, a UNESCO World Heritage site that houses numerous rock-cut churches and monastic complexes.

As you step into these ancient cave churches, you will be captivated by the breathtaking frescoes that adorn the walls and ceilings. These intricate paintings depict scenes from the Bible, offering a glimpse into the religious beliefs and stories of the past. The skilled craftsmanship and attention to detail displayed in these frescoes are truly awe-inspiring.
